原文:[Shell]通過shell修改build.gradle配置文件

我的需求: 自動化打包前,修改版本號 思路如下: .獲取要修改字符串在build.gradle配置文件的所在行 .整行刪除舊字符串 .新將新字符串寫入配置文件 技術點: sed讀寫配置文件 獲取指定字符串所在行 將字符串寫入配置文件指定位置 指定行 拼接字符串,字符串包含特殊符號,雙隱號,單隱號,轉義符號的使用 build.gradle配置文件內容如下: 腳本如下: ...

2020-01-03 14:09 0 1679 推薦指數:

查看詳情

Gradle入門到精通(三)- 配置文件build.gradle

一、Gradle工程中下載的jar包,默認放在哪兒的? 使用IDEA創建一個Gradle工程時會加載很多信息,類似這樣的: 這些信息放到哪里的呢? 打開File --》Settings,其中 Service directory path 的配置路徑告訴了我們這個位置,這里為C ...

Wed Feb 03 19:35:00 CST 2021 0 309
build.gradle文件介紹

對於以前用Eclipse開發安卓的小伙伴來說,Gradle文件是陌生的。 不同於Eclipse,而Android Studio 是采用Gradle來構建項目的。 先來介紹最外層目錄下的build.gradle文件,代碼如下: 在repositories閉包中: jcenter():它是 ...

Sun Jan 08 04:36:00 CST 2017 1 12830
解析build.gradle文件

Gradle是一個非常先進的項目構建工具,它使用了一種基於Groovy的領域特定語言DSL來聲明項目設置,摒棄了傳統XML(如Ant和Maven)的各種繁瑣配置 項目結構如上圖: 1、最外層目錄下的build.gradle文件(通常情況下不需要修改這個文件內容),代碼如下所示 ...

Sat Aug 18 20:02:00 CST 2018 0 2541
build.gradle文件的注釋

  Gradle是一種依賴管理工具,基於Froovy語言,面向Java應用為主,它拋棄了基於xml的各種繁瑣配置,取而代之的是一種基於Groovy的內部領域特定(DSL)語言。 ...

Mon May 22 17:55:00 CST 2017 1 7136
shell動態修改yml配置文件

環境准備 使用python來對yml文件內容進行讀寫操作,然后在shell中調用python 編寫python腳本 python2 shell調用python並傳遞參數 ...

Fri Mar 26 23:53:00 CST 2021 0 2205
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M